## page was renamed from Ubuntu/Lucid/Déploiement/PosteClientFixe Cette page présente le modèle de poste de travail AuF fixe sous ''Ubuntu « Lucid » 10.04''. <> = Installation automatique (recommandée) = == Configurer le démarrage sur le réseau == * aller dans le BIOS activer le démarrage sur le réseau . {i} Cela change hélas d'un BIOS à l'autre… Il faut activer les options portant des noms comme ''Boot on LAN'', ''Network boot'', ''Int 19h'', ''Add-on ROM'', … * redémarrer la machine pour que les changements soient pris en compte et que le démarrage réseau soit disponible dans les choix proposés * retourner dans le BIOS pour choisir le réseau en premier dans l'ordre de démarrage (''Boot order'') == Démarrer l'installation == * au démarrage de la machine sur le réseau, choisir l'option ''Lucid sauce AuF'' * laisser l'installation se faire sans aucune intervention, jusqu'à ce que la machine s'éteigne toute seule, ce qui indiquera que l'installation s'est bien terminée /!\ L'installation automatique ne sera pleinement fonctionnelle qu'à la condition que le serveur bureautique ait bien été configuré selon le [[../ServeurBureautique|modèle préconisé]]. {i} L'installation ne sera 100% automatique qu'à la condition que vous ayez choisi de configurer un partitionnement automatique dans le fichier [[../PreseedAuFFixe|preseed]]. Dans le cas contraire l'installation commencera, vous demandera de faire le partitionnement, puis continuera de façon automatique pour le reste. {i} L'installation 100% automatisée prend environ 1 heure si vous avez un miroir ''Ubuntu Lucid'' local complet (''main'', ''restricted'', ''universe'' et ''multiverse'' pour ''archive'' et ''security'', ainsi que ''partner'', ''auf'' et ''openoffice''), dans le cas contraire cela peut prendre beaucoup plus de temps, genre 1 journée entière ou plus. == Terminer la configuration == {i} Les utilisateurs réseau ne pourront pas se connecter avant cette dernière étape. * configurer les accès à la base des utilisateurs réseau, par exemple : {{{ ssh root@lucid libnss-mysql-bg-config -w mot-de-passe-user -W mot-de-passe-root }}} . (!) vérifier sur le poste avec `getent passwd` (en utilisateur normal) et `getent shadow` (sous `root`) * reconfigurer l'imprimante PDF virtuelle : ''(toujours pas trouvé comment l'automatiser)'' {{{ ssh root@lucid dpkg-reconfigure cups-pdf }}} . (!) vérifier avec `lpstat -p` Le poste de travail est maintenant utilisable par tous les utilisateurs réseau. <> = Installation manuelle (non recommandée) = * installer le système ''Ubuntu “Lucid Lynx” 10.04 LTS'' avec toutes les dernières mises à jour * partager le disque en 15 Gio pour le système et 5 Gio d'espace d'échange (`swap`), le reste en LVM * créer un compte `auf` qui servira à l'administration de la machine * installer le logiciel de démarrage (`grub`) sur le secteur de démarrage (`MBR`) * installer et configurer la langue française si ça n'a pas été fait lors de l'installation : {{{ sudo dpkg-reconfigure locales # choisir fr_FR.UTF-8 par défaut }}} . (!) ajoutez éventuellement d'autres langues au passage, dans leur version Unicode (`.UTF-8`) * configurer au moins les sources APT suivantes dans `/etc/apt/sources.list` : {{{ deb http://archive.ubuntu.com/ubuntu/ lucid main restricted universe multiverse deb http://archive.ubuntu.com/ubuntu/ lucid-updates main restricted universe multiverse deb http://security.ubuntu.com/ubuntu lucid-security main restricted universe multiverse deb http://archive.canonical.com/ubuntu lucid partner deb http://apt.auf.org/ lucid auf openoffice }}} . (!) ajouter un `#` devant les lignes commençant par `deb-src`, cela accélérera les mises à jour * valider le dépôt AuF en lançant les commandes suivantes : {{{ wget -O- http://apt.auf.org/auf-keyring.gpg | sudo apt-key add - sudo aptitude update }}} * installer les paquets AuF minimum : {{{ sudo aptitude install auf-keyring auf-client-fixe auf-client-logiciels auf-client-openoffice-migration auf-client-fonds-d-ecran }}} . (!) on installera éventuellement une variante locale telle que `auf-client-logiciels-vi` * dans le cas d'un poste servant à faire de l'édition (graphique, publication, …), lancer aussi : {{{ sudo aptitude install auf-client-logiciels-edition }}} * dans le cas d'un poste de travail de personnel AuF, installer des paquets supplémentaires : {{{ sudo aptitude install auf-modeles-openoffice auf-client-menu auf-poste-client-reflets }}} * configurer les accès à la base des utilisateurs réseau, par exemple : {{{ sudo libnss-mysql-bg-config -w mot-de-passe-user -W mot-de-passe-root }}} . (!) vérifier sur le poste avec `getent passwd` (en utilisateur normal) et `getent shadow` (sous `root`) * lier le `/home` avec celui partagé par le serveur NFS, par exemple : {{{ # déplacement du "/home" actuel vers "/home.local" sed -i 's|:/home/|:/home.local/|' /etc/passwd mv /home /home.local ln -s /net/nfs/home /home }}} . /!\ '''ATTENTION :''' à ne pas faire depuis l'interface graphique mais en mode console ! * installer les clés SSH de gestion des postes clients dans les comptes `root` et `auf` * relancer la machine Le poste de travail est maintenant utilisable par tous les utilisateurs réseau.